1993-1995 Away Player Shirt (Small Carlsberg)
This away shirt was used by Liverpool in season 1993-1994 and 1994-1995. This away shirt is characterised by three slanted parallel white stripes on each side in front which leads to the nick-name of "ribs" shirt. There are no long sleeved replicas produced for this shirt.
There were two versions existed - the one with small Carlsberg sponsor (size is exactly the same as replicas) and the one with big Carlsberg sponsor.
Featured Jamie Redknapp wearing the 1993-1995 away player shirt with big Carlsberg sposnor.
Featured rookie Michael Owen wearing the 1993-1995 away player shirt with small Carlsberg sponsor.
A standard away replica shirt has rubber embossed Adidas motif and club crest.
A genuine away player shirt (small Carlsberg version) has embroidered Adidas motif and club crest.
